35,000 meals for hungry children in Central Florida to be packed Saturday
On Saturday, Orlando City fans, along with community members and volunteers, will be packing meals to help feed local children in the Central Florida area. The partnership with Feeding Children Everywhere is the second collaborative event between the two organizations.

On May 26, FCE collected donations at the Orlando match against the Charlotte Eagles, raising over $1,400 dollars for the packing event. Along with the money raised from the 50/50 raffle on the 26th, the two organizations were able to generate around $2,000 for the event on Saturday.

For every one dollar raised, FCE packages and ships four meals to hungry children. With the help of donations and more, the goal on Saturday will be to package 35,000 meals.

Feeding Children Everywhere Director of Social Media Allison Belles commented on where the food would be going and how the program works.

“We work on a need basis,” she said. “We work with local guidance counselors and schools in the Orlando area to make sure their food supplies are never out. That’s the most important thing. We want to make sure no child goes to school without proper meals there.”

Orlando City fans have been quick to volunteer, as Belles says they are booked on Saturday. “It’s amazing to see so many spots filled up,” she says. “We’re blown away at the number of people volunteering on Saturday. We had to open up more (around 300) due to high demand.”

The event runs from 8 a.m. – 2 p.m on Saturday. Belles said FCE is ready and knows the event will be successful.

“We’re bringing people together for a common cause. Everyone here (at FCE) are big soccer fans and we couldn’t be more excited to have an Orlando City packing event.”
